The Minutemen have been relying heavily on their key players, especially running back Kay’Ron Lynch-Adams who has been impressive with 144 rushing attempts accumulating 692 rushing yards and 6 rushing touchdowns. Complementing Adams is wide receiver Anthony Simpson, who boasts 568 receiving yards from 36 receptions, and has managed to find the endzone 3 times this season.

 

On the other hand, the Army Black Knights showcase their strength with running back Kanye Udoh. He has amassed 288 rushing yards from 53 attempts and has a rushing touchdown to his name. Not to forget wide receiver Isaiah Alston, who despite having only 9 receptions, has accumulated an impressive 266 receiving yards, averaging 29.6 yards per reception.

Carlos Davis QB vs. Bryson Daily QB

 

The Minutemen’s Carlos Davis has had a commendable season thus far, with a completion percentage of 61.4%, totaling 886 passing yards from 101 attempts. He has thrown 6 touchdown passes but has also been intercepted 3 times. Davis’s strength lies in his ability to stay calm under pressure and make decisive throws. However, his vulnerability arises when facing aggressive defensive lines, having been sacked 6 times leading to a loss of 50 yards this season.

 

On the opposite end, Bryson Daily of the Black Knights, though having fewer completions at 42 from 77 attempts, boasts a higher yards per pass average at 9.2 and has matched Davis with 6 passing touchdowns. While Daily’s passing accuracy of 54.5% may be a concern, his resilience in the pocket is notable. He has faced similar challenges, being sacked 6 times resulting in a loss of 39 yards. Daily’s game thrives on quick decisions and exploiting defensive gaps.
